Water Main Break 4/20/2026 - UPDATE
Updated 11:28 am 4/21
There is a boil water advisory due to the water main break on 4/20/2026. Visit the county website at https://greenecountyva.gov/DocumentCenter/View/1686/Boil-Water-Advisory-April-20-2026-PDF for instructions regarding how to boil water. Properties affected include Fairlane Drive off Route 33, Briar Patch off Route 33, Industrial Drive off Route 33 in Ruckersville and everything west of that down U.S. Route 33 including the Town of Stanardsville. This only applies if you are on the County water system and not well or other water system in Greene County. Tests will be done on the water system and once completed, you will be notified through the same way that the boil water advisory is lifted.

A private contractor doing work for a private project hit a water connection near the Industrial Park in Ruckersville, causing a shut down and loss of pressure for all water users west of the Industrial Park to include all of Stanardsville. There is no estimate at this time regarding a fix and water pressure rebuild, but crews from the water department are on site and working on it now.
